Abstract

Spectral analysis methods are widely used for the analysis of different targets such as viruses, bacteria, heavy metals and their harmful substances due to their simplicity and efficiency. Among these spectral analysis methods, the study of luminescence and light absorption of different substances has important theoretical and practical significance. Atoms are different and emit different bright-line spectra, and the atoms of each element have a certain bright-line spectrum. Therefore, a diverse of different spectroscopic techniques can be used to achieve various target detection. In this research, four common spectral analysis methods are introduced, including Raman spectroscopic analysis, electroluminescence analysis, fluorescence analysis and colorimetric analysis. And this research analyzes the detection effect of these four spectral analysis methods on different targets, such as virus and pathogens.
